About Nicolas Crouzet

Nicolas Crouzet is a scholar working on Instrumentation, Astronomy and Astrophysics and Aerospace Engineering, having authored 31 papers that have together received 394 indexed citations. Recurring topics across this work include Stellar, planetary, and galactic studies (22 papers), Astronomy and Astrophysical Research (9 papers) and Astrophysics and Star Formation Studies (8 papers). The work is most often cited by research in Instrumentation (84 citations), Astronomy and Astrophysics (247 citations) and Aerospace Engineering (112 citations). Nicolas Crouzet has collaborated with scholars based in France, United Kingdom and United States. Frequent co-authors include Nikku Madhusudhan, Christina Hedges, P. R. McCullough, Drake Deming, Dan Gabriel Cacuci, Dominique Bestion, Frank-Peter Weiß, Víctor Hugo Sánchez-Espinoza, S. Kliem and E. Pallé. Their work appears in journals such as SHILAP Revista de lepidopterología, The Astrophysical Journal and Monthly Notices of the Royal Astronomical Society.
